Assume X is distributed Binomial with 50 trials. You decide to sample from X and get a sample mean of 11 and sample variance of 8. 1. Assume we had sampled 2 observations from X to get those sample characteristics Can we conduct a hypothesis test on the variance? 2. Assume instead we sampled 31 observations from X to get those sample characteristics. At the 10% level of significance, test your belief that the population variance is larger than 7. 3. Solve for the two-sided 95% confidence interval for the population variance. 4. Solve for the one-sided 95% confidence interval for the population variance given the direction set out in number 2
